DimensionOperatorSquare Appointments
PriceAutopilot is $499/mo with a 14-day money-back guarantee. Unlimited users. Cancel any time.Free solo tier and paid team tiers. Payment processing fees apply on all tiers.
Core functionBusiness operating system: visibility, reviews, market intelligence, bookkeeping automation, job coordination.Appointment booking, calendar management, and point of sale. Booking is the primary value proposition.
Local rankingHealth Score (0 to 100) updated nightly. Six ranked components including Google visibility and competitive position.None. Square Appointments does not measure or improve your search visibility.
Review managementOffice Manager monitors Google reviews, drafts responses, and tracks review velocity against competitors.No review management. Square Feedback exists as a separate product but handles internal satisfaction, not Google review management.
Market intelligenceMarket Analyst tracks nearby competitors nightly. Flags ranking shifts and revenue opportunities.None. Square reports on your own bookings and revenue only.
Booking and calendarField Coordinator manages scheduling and job routing for your team.Full client-facing booking page, calendar sync (Google, iCal), automated reminders, waitlist management. Strong booking tools.
Payment processingStripe integration. Standard Stripe rates. No platform fee on top.Square payment processing fees apply. Hardware is required for card-present payments.
Bookkeeping automationBookkeeper handles invoice creation, payment reminders, and overdue flags.Basic reporting on Square Dashboard. No automated accounts receivable or overdue management.
AI search visibilityIndexed by ChatGPT, Claude, Perplexity, Gemini. MCP server at /api/mcp. All AI crawlers allowed.Internal scheduling tool. AI visibility is not a Square Appointments product concern.
Target customerAny local service business: home services, health, wellness, beauty, fitness, professional services.Primarily beauty, wellness, and personal services. Also used by salons, barbershops, med spas, and fitness instructors.
Free tierMarket Analyst forever free. Health Score, competitor ranking, market alerts at no cost.Free solo plan with payment fees. Core booking features are available for a single user.

Is Operator a Square Appointments alternative?
Partial. Operator replaces Square Appointments for market intelligence, review management, and business visibility tools. Square Appointments is better for client-facing booking pages and calendar management, especially for beauty and wellness businesses that rely on repeat appointment scheduling. Many owners use Operator alongside Square for the visibility layer.
I use Square for payments. Will Operator conflict?
No. Operator does not replace your payment processor. You can keep Square for in-person and card-present payments and use Operator for the business intelligence and automation layer. There is no direct conflict.
